Aggregates are composed of geological materials such as stone, sand, and gravel and are used in virtually all forms of construction. They can be used in their natural state or can be crushed into smaller pieces. The aggregates used for building are called “construction aggregates”. The designed processing capacity of the coarse crushing area is 1500t/h, and the pebbles of the foundation pit are transported to the raw material warehouse and the grate silo for processing by dumping and trucking. Aggregate larger than 300mm enters the jaw crusher for crushing, equipped with a F5X1045 vibrating feeder and a PEW760 jaw crusher.

Crushed stone aggregates are produced by crushing quarried rock, then screening it to sizes appropriate for the intended use. Production of crushed stone has three stages: Primary crushing to break down the stone to a manageable size; secondary and tertiary crushing to render the rocks into sizes specific to their applications; and screening to separate the crushed stone for further processing

Aggregate is produced from about 135 crushed stone quarries and about 500 sand and gravel sites throughout the state. Crushed stone, sand and gravel plants account for 85 percent of all permitted mining operations. The average production life of a crushed stone quarry is 40 to 50 years or more.

A-Z Guide to Screening Ore, Rock & Aggregate. A simple definition of a “screen” is a machine with surface (s) used to classify materials by size. Screening is defined as “The mechanical process which accomplishes a division of particles on the basis of size and their acceptance or rejection by a screening surface”.

Crushed stone, gravel and sand encompass the bulk of the materials used in highway construction, whether for flexible asphalt, rigid concrete or unbound pavements.
Natural aggregate: Weathering and erosion of rocks produce particles of stone, gravel, sand, silt, and clay. Natural gravel and sand are usually dug or dredged from a pit, river, lake, or seabed. Some natural aggregate deposits of gravel and sand can be readily used in concrete with minimal processing.

11.19.2 Crushed Stone Processing and Pulverized Mineral Processing 11.19.2.1 Process Description 24, 25 Crushed Stone Processing Major rock types processed by the crushed stone industry include limestone, granite, dolomite, traprock, sandstone, quartz, and quartzite. Minor types include calcareous marl, marble, shell, and slate.

Aggregates are granular, inert materials, construction aggregate, or simply "aggregate", is a broad category of coarse particulate material used in construction, including sand, gravel, crushed stone, slag, recycled concrete and geo-synthetic aggregates. Aggregates are the most mined material in the world. It usually produces by aggregate crushing plant.
